Freigeben über


Algorithmusobjekt

[CAPICOM ist eine nur 32-Bit-Komponente, die für die Verwendung in den folgenden Betriebssystemen verfügbar ist: Windows Server 2008, Windows Vista, Windows XP. Verwenden Sie stattdessen die AlgorithmIdentifier-Klasse im System.Security.Cryptography.Pkcs-Namespace .]

Das Algorithm-Objekt gibt den Algorithmus an, der zum Signieren, Umhüllen und Verschlüsseln von Vorgängen verwendet wird.

Verwendung

Das Algorithm-Objekt wird verwendet, um die folgenden Aufgaben auszuführen:

  • Legen Sie den zu verwendenden Algorithmus fest, oder rufen Sie diesen ab.
  • Legen Sie die Schlüssellänge fest oder rufen Sie sie ab.

Hinweis

CAPICOM versucht, den Systemstandard-Kryptografiedienstanbieter (CSP) zu verwenden. Wenn dieser CSP den angeforderten Algorithmus oder die angeforderte Schlüssellänge nicht bereitstellen kann, sucht CAPICOM nach einem von Microsoft bereitgestellten CSP, der den angeforderten Algorithmus und die Schlüssellänge in dieser Verfügbarkeitsreihenfolge verarbeiten kann: Microsoft Enhanced Cryptographic Provider, Microsoft Strong Cryptographic Provider, Microsoft Base Cryptographic Provider.

 

Member

Das Algorithm-Objekt verfügt über die folgenden Membertypen:

Eigenschaften

Das Algorithm-Objekt verfügt über diese Eigenschaften.

Eigenschaft Zugriffstyp BESCHREIBUNG
KeyLength
Lesen/Schreiben
Legt die Länge des Schlüssels fest oder ruft sie ab.
Name
Lesen/Schreiben
Legt den Algorithmus fest oder ruft den Algorithmus ab, der zum Signieren, Umhüllen und Verschlüsseln von Vorgängen verwendet wird. Das ist die Standardeigenschaft.

 

Bemerkungen

Das Algorithm-Objekt kann nicht erstellt werden.

Anforderungen

Anforderung Wert
Ende des Supports (Client)
Windows Vista
Ende des Supports (Server)
WindowsServer 2008
Verteilbare Komponente
CAPICOM 2.0 oder höher unter Windows Server 2003 und Windows XP
Header
Capicom.h
DLL
Capicom.dll

Siehe auch

Kryptografieobjekte